What to Know About Panabo
Key Facts
Panabo is a component city located in the province of Davao del Norte within the Davao Region of the Philippines. Situated along the southeastern coast of Mindanao island, Panabo occupies a strategic position approximately 35 kilometers north of Davao City, serving as an important urban center in the province. The city covers a land area of approximately 251.23 square kilometers and has a population of around 209,230 people according to recent census data, making it one of the more densely populated areas in Davao del Norte. Panabo is administratively divided into 40 barangays, which serve as the fundamental political units governing local affairs. The city's economy is primarily driven by agriculture, with vast banana plantations dominating the landscape and earning Panabo the nickname 'Banana Capital of the Philippines.' Its location along the Davao Gulf provides access to marine resources while its proximity to major transportation routes facilitates commerce and trade.
